What to do if you find a Sick, Injured Or Abandoned Wild Animal
If you see what you think may be a sick, injured or abandoned animal, don’t remove it from its natural habitat. It may not need assistance and you could do more harm trying to help. First, figure out whether or not the animal has been abandoned. Some species leave their offspring alone temporarily,…
